[VIDEO] Why Won't the Supernova Explode?

A question has been troubling astronomers: Why won't the supernova explode? Although real stars blow up, the best computer models of dying stars do not result in much of a bang. NASA has launched a new observatory named "NuSTAR" to seek out the missing physics of exploding stars.

[VIDEO] Life's Elements Seen in Supernova Remnant

"We are star stuff, harvesting starlight"' wrote Carl Sagan in 1978. In 2012, the Chandra X-ray Observatory harvested a signature of inner star elements on the outskirts of a supernova - elements that Sagan and others termed "the stuff of life."

Supernova May Have Kicked Off Solar System - Science News

Supernova May Have Kicked Off Solar System - Science News | Science News | Scoop.it

Scientists have found a recipe for cooking the solar system from scratch: take a cold cloud of gas, and set it 15 light-years from an exploding supernova. Stun the cloud with the supernova’s shockwave. Incubate, and watch as the solar system begins to take shape.

[VIDEO] The Supernova That Rocked Neutrino Physics

[VIDEO] The Supernova That Rocked Neutrino Physics | Science News | Scoop.it

On February 23, 1987, neutrino physics changed forever. Here, particle physicist Lawrence Krauss of Arizona State University explains at the World Science Festival program, The Elusive Neutrino and the Nature of the Cosmos, how the rare sighting of an exploding star—a supernova—delivered tantalizing proof of the elusive neutrino, and confirmed the laws of physics.

The diamonds that are born in supernovae

The diamonds that are born in supernovae | Science News | Scoop.it
Black diamonds, also known as carbonados, are dark, porous, and found only in Brazil and Central Africa. And they don't come from volcanoes — they come from outer space.
